Jadoopur
Jadoopur is a village located in Lambhua tehsil of Sultanpur district in Uttar Pradesh, India. It is situated 10km away from sub-district headquarter Lambhuaa (tehsildar office) and 33km away from district headquarter Sultanpur. As per 2009 stats, Jaddupur is the gram panchayat of Jadoopur village.

About Jadoopur
According to Census 2011, the location code or village code of Jadoopur is 170688. The village spans a total geographical area of 38.73 hectares, and the pincode of the locality is 222302. Koiripur is nearest town to Jadoopur village for all major economic activities, which is approximately 28km away.

Population of Jadoopur
According to the 2011 Census, Jadoopur has a total population of about 138, with approximately 69 males and 69 females. The sex ratio is around 1000 females per 1,000 males. Children aged 0 to 6 years make up about 19 of the population, showing the young generation present in the village. There are about 9 members of the Scheduled Castes (SC), an important community in the village. Information about the Scheduled Tribes (ST) population is not available. The overall literacy rate is approximately 65.94%, with male literacy at about 73.91% and female literacy near 57.97%. There are around 23 households in the village. Particulars | Total | Male | Female |
---|---|---|---|
Total Population | 138 | 69 | 69 |
Child Population (0–6 yrs) | 19 | 10 | 9 |
Scheduled Castes (SC) | 9 | 5 | 4 |
Scheduled Tribes (ST) | N/A | N/A | N/A |
Literate Population | 91 | 51 | 40 |
Illiterate Population | 47 | 18 | 29 |
Connectivity of Jadoopur
Connectivity plays a major role in improving access, opportunities, and overall development of villages like Jadoopur. As per the 2011 stats, Jadoopur had access to public bus service, private bus service and railway station.
Connectivity Type | Status (in year 2011) |
---|---|
Public Bus Service | Available within 5 - 10 km distance |
Private Bus Service | Available within 5 - 10 km distance |
Railway Station | Available within 5 - 10 km distance |
